Protein crystallography data

The structure of Crystal Structure of Phospho-CDK2 Cyclin A in Complex with A Peptide Containing Both the Substrate and Recruitment Sites of CDC6, PDB code: 2cci was solved by K.Y.Cheng, M.E.M.Noble, V.Skamnaki, N.R.Brown, E.D.Lowe, L.Kontogiannis, K.Shen, P.A.Cole, G.Siligardi, L.N.Johnson, with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:

Resolution Low / High (Å) 94.92 / 2.70
Space group P 21 21 21
Cell size a, b, c (Å), α, β, γ (°) 74.420, 114.389, 170.709, 90.00, 90.00, 90.00
R / Rfree (%) 26.1 / 32.1
